I have an MEP-804A with a 50/60 15KW TRC Voltage Regulator that was running normally before the radiator leaked. I had the radiator fixed and reinstalled. When I went to start it, it’s giving me an under voltage fault light. I had found a previous post with the test sequence to check the TRC voltage regulator and found it to be no good according to the posted test procedure. Changed it out with a known working one and also replaced the KTK-3 fuse with a brand new one.
When I started it and tried to flip the AC CIRCUIT INTERUPTER switch to closed to turn on the 3 phase power, it doesn’t stay on. The frequency and voltage gauges jump when starting but that’s about it. Frequency gauge jumps and goes back to 48, voltage gauge goes to about 5.
When I hold the start switch in the start position, I can illuminate the AC Circuit Interupter and get the 3 phase power, but as soon as I let go and it goes back to the run position, the under voltage light comes on.
